Red Flags
Red Flags
Recent Avalanches
Wind Loading
Red Flags Comments
Large avalanche off of the ridge NE of peak 7990 as seen in photos. I saw it from a distance and it appears to be from the last day or two and possibly into the PWL. This is at about 7600 ft and appears to be 300-400 ft. wide. Today, to cracking or collapsing.
Avalanche Problem #1
Problem
Persistent Weak Layer
Problem #1 Comments
At 7600 ft the PWL is now at 100cm down. Not sure how to assess the stability of this layer now that it is buried so deep? However it is still there and concerning. In the North Ogden divide area the PWL is only down 60 cm at most at the same elevation.
Avalanche Problem #2
Problem
Wind Drifted Snow
Problem #2 Comments
Soft sensitive wind slab on the exposed ridges.
